MyBlogLog Adds Tagging Functionality

The popular blog-tracking community MyBlogLog has just added tagging functionality into their suite of blog metrics. Now, when you are viewing a members profile or a community you have the option to label with tags. Hovering the mouse over the tags will reveal which users have tagged the profile or community with the tag you’re hovering over.

Tags are also clickable. When clicking a tag you are taken to a list of all the members or communities that have been labeled with that corresponding tag. Finally, when viewing the tag page that lists members/communities who have been tagged with that word, you can hover the mouse over items to see who tagged them.
